Сервер кэширования для .NET (пример Memcached) - PullRequest
7 голосов
/ 20 мая 2011

Я ищу кеш-сервер для .NET. Что ты можешь предложить? Как я знаю, у memcached есть провайдер для .net. Это достаточно хорошо для использования для .net в производстве?

Ответы [ 6 ]

8 голосов
/ 20 мая 2011

AppFabric - еще одно популярное решение от Microsoft.

5 голосов
/ 20 мая 2011

Если вы хотите запустить свой сервер кеша в Linux, вы можете использовать Redis и использовать библиотеку BookSleeve из .NET, это то, что использует StackOverflow

http://code.google.com/p/booksleeve/

3 голосов
/ 20 мая 2011

Scale Out State Server - отличное решение. Это не бесплатно, но для крупномасштабных приложений , это один из лучших вариантов, которые мы нашли.

NCache - еще один вариант, хотя у меня нет с ним опыта.

Для масштаба предприятия (и бюджета) есть Когерентность Oracle . Это работает очень хорошо, хотя это очень дорого.

Вот еще один вопрос SO с некоторой информацией, которая может или не может быть полезной:
Решения для кэширования

2 голосов
/ 20 мая 2011

Memached достаточно хорош для производства, вероятно, лучше всего использовать enyim провайдера .

Couchbase обеспечивает хороший веб-интерфейс и простую установку memcached на windows.Бесплатно, если на одном сервере.Замечательно иметь возможность контролировать ваш экземпляр кэша.

Они заплатили за решения, но и их собственный сервер.

AppFabric, как уже упоминалось, является еще одним очевидным кандидатом, но не настолько зрелым, как memcached.AppFabric - это сервер приложений, который также может обеспечить распределенное кэширование, например membase

1 голос
/ 20 мая 2011

См. Пост Лучшие кеширующие библиотеки для .NET с несколькими вариантами, включая как бесплатные, так и коммерческие. Выбор будет зависеть от вашей реальной потребности.

0 голосов
/ 23 июля 2012

, хотя существует множество сторонних решений для кэширования, доступных для .NET, но если мы сузим исследование, основанное на Google и из уст в уста, это может быть 1) Memcached 2) Appfabric 3) NCache

Во-первых, это бесплатное программное обеспечение с открытым исходным кодом, поэтому у них есть некоторые ограничения, в то время как с другой стороны, NCache может предложить многое по сравнению с другими, но вы должны его купить. но у него также есть бесплатная версия, которая называется NCache Express. Ниже приведены две важные ссылки в этом отношении,

Видео на NCache Vs AppFabric

Блог о NCache Vs AppFabric

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...